Alabama Most Popular Male Baby Names in 1995

In 1995, the most popular name for baby boys in Alabama was William, with a count of 628 boys out of a total of 24,685 registered names of baby boys (i.e. 2.54% of the total number of new-born baby boys in Alabama in 1995). The second most popular boy name was Christopher (605 boys, 2.45% of total). The third most popular boy name was James (554 boys, 2.24% of total).

Alabama Most Popular Female Baby Names in 1995

In 1995, the most popular name for baby girls in Alabama was Jessica, with a count of 451 girls out of a total of 20,747 registered names of baby girls (i.e. 2.17% of the total number of new-born baby girls in Alabama in 1995). The second most popular girl name was Ashley (429 girls, 2.07% of total). The third most popular girl name was Hannah (391 girls, 1.89% of total).
